The Core Networking team is looking for a Network Development Engineer to join our Network Fabric Engineering (NFE) team. As a Network Development Engineer you will be responsible for building deploying and scaling the Amazon networks that support AWS customers and other business units across multiple global datacenters.
AWS Core Networking is focused on building Data Centers and the network that allows Data Centers to function efficiently. We own the solutions that allow racks to be aggregated and Data Centers to be interconnected. Core Networkings goal is to balance efficiency performance and reliability to allow customers access to their applications and data.

About the team
AWS NFE (Network Fabric Engineering) owns datacenter network services that provide unconstrained connectivity to our customers such as EC2 EBS S3 and Amazon CDO Services. They own the networks internal to the datacenters end to end including scaling and operational functions for both traditional datacenters. They also own newer AWS offerings such as Outposts and Local Zones.
